Transaction 61322da80e7d3a63e9c7bfab78755ae14c613edc9c244ba0f6bc17603d6add3d

block
5a91083fd11bd6d20eccb631a747f45edd5b4e3b24a7237d955df498cde496ac

1 Input

23 Outputs